Design Philosophies: Horn versus Traditional Driver

The R-52C features Klipsch's signature horn-loaded tweeter, a design choice that promises high efficiency and a reduction in distortion. This translates to a sound that can be aggressive and forward, often a boon for dialogue clarity in film and television content. The Borea BR03, with its silk dome tweeter and traditional driver layout, opts for a smoother, more nuanced treble response. This difference is one of philosophy as much as it is of sound—where Klipsch seeks to command the room, Triangle aims to seduce it.

Power handling is another critical factor to consider. The R-52C, with its high sensitivity, requires less power to achieve loud volumes, making it an excellent match for a wide range of AV receivers. Triangle's BR03, while not particularly power-hungry, benefits from a bit more amplification to unlock its full potential, especially in the low-end where these bookshelf speakers can surprise with their bass response.

One must also consider the versatility of these speakers. The Klipsch R-52C is purpose-built for the home theater, excelling in its role by anchoring dialogue right to the action on the screen. The Triangle Borea BR03, being a bookshelf speaker, offers greater flexibility, performing admirably in a stereo setup for music and, if paired with other members of the Borea series, can also serve as part of a cohesive surround system.
